For the best sausage gravy with biscuits, try this recipe at home and you won't even have to wait to order them at a restaurant. Creamy, meaty, and savory... each bite is nice and salty with a slight kick of spice from the hot sauce.
Ingredients
- 1 pound bulk country sausage
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 0.25 cups all-purpose flour
- 2.5 cups milk , or more as needed
- 2 teaspoons hot sauce
- 0.5 teaspoons ground black pepper
- 0.25 teaspoons salt
- 6 hots biscuits , split
Instructions
-
1
Heat sausage in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Cook, crumbling with a spoon and stirring often, until browned and cooked through, 5 to 7 minutes.
-
2
Add butter to skillet and melt. Sprinkle flour evenly over skillet and stir for 1 minute. Whisk in 2 1/2 cups milk and scrape up any bits off the bottom of the skillet. Bring mixture to a simmer.
-
3
Reduce heat to low and cook, stirring often, until thickened, about 10 minutes. If mixture becomes too thick, thin slightly by adding more milk or water. Season with hot sauce, pepper, and salt; cook for 1 more minute.
-
4
Serve immediately over hot biscuits.
